Merry & Bright, North by Night Window Display Competition!

There's nothing quite like the holiday season in the North End of Halifax. The neighbourhood is filled with festive décor and the local businesses are in full holiday mode. The annual North End Halifax Holiday Window Display competition is a celebration of this community spirit and creativity.
